2017-03-20 38 views
0

我想關閉mail-smtp端口。我可以關閉Wildfly上的mail-smtp端口嗎?

<socket-binding-group name="standard-sockets" 
default-interface="public" port-offset="${jboss.socket.binding.port-offset:0}"> 
    <!--<outbound-socket-binding name="mail-smtp">--> 
     <!--<remote-destination host="localhost" port="25"/>--> 
    <!--</outbound-socket-binding>--> 
</socket-binding-group> 

如果我不使用郵件,我可以禁用郵件子系統嗎?

<subsystem xmlns="urn:jboss:domain:mail:2.0"> 
     <mail-session name="default" jndi-name="java:jboss/mail/Default"> 
      <smtp-server outbound-socket-binding-ref="mail-smtp"/> 
     </mail-session> 
    </subsystem> 

回答

2

如果您刪除的郵件服務,子系統可以去掉

刪除擴展:<extension module="org.jboss.as.mail"/>

取出完整的子系統郵件:

<subsystem xmlns="urn:jboss:domain:mail:2.0"> 
    <mail-session name="default" jndi-name="java:jboss/mail/Default"> 
     <smtp-server outbound-socket-binding-ref="mail-smtp"/> 
    </mail-session> 
</subsystem> 

刪除出站套接字綁定郵件-smtp

<outbound-socket-binding name="mail-smtp"> 
    <remote-destination host="localhost" port="25"/> 
</outbound-socket-binding> 

您也可以使用CLI刪除子系統:

/subsystem=mail:remove 
/socket-binding-group=standard-sockets/remote-destination-outbound-socket-binding=mail-smtp:remove 
/extension=org.jboss.as.mail:remove 
:reload 
相關問題